1. Product Overview
This manual provides instructions for the safe and efficient operation and maintenance of your MXBAOHENG 50 Gallon Pneumatic Paint Mixer. This air-powered agitator is designed for mixing various liquids, including paints, chemicals, food products, pharmaceuticals, and cosmetics, in containers up to 50 gallons (200 liters).
Key Features
- Stainless Steel Rod & Blade: Equipped with a 304 stainless steel stirring rod and blade, ensuring durability and resistance to rust and corrosion.
- Stepless Speed Regulation: A valve at the air inlet allows for precise adjustment of the mixing speed (0-1440 r/min) to suit the viscosity of the material being mixed.
- Pneumatic Motor: Features a 1/2 HP pneumatic motor, providing safe operation in environments where electrical sparks are a concern.
- High Capacity: Designed for mixing materials in 50 Gallon (200L) tanks.
- Adjustable Clamp: Includes a robust, adjustable clamp with a shockproof gasket for secure and stable attachment to various barrel rims, reducing vibration.
- Integrated Silencer: Comes with a silencer for reduced noise during operation, enhancing user comfort and safety.
2. Safety Information
Read and understand all safety warnings and instructions before operating this pneumatic mixer. Failure to follow these instructions may result in serious injury or property damage.
- Personal Protective Equipment (PPE): Always wear appropriate PPE, including safety glasses or goggles, hearing protection, and gloves, when operating the mixer.
- Stable Mounting: Ensure the mixer is securely clamped to a stable tank or barrel before connecting the air supply and operating.
- Air Supply: Use a clean, dry, regulated air supply within the specified pressure range (6-9mpa / 87-130 psi). Disconnect the air supply before performing any adjustments, maintenance, or when the mixer is not in use.
- Ventilation: Operate the mixer in a well-ventilated area, especially when mixing paints, solvents, or chemicals that may produce hazardous fumes.
- Material Compatibility: Ensure the materials being mixed are compatible with stainless steel components and do not pose a fire or explosion hazard when agitated.
- Clearance: Keep hands, clothing, and other objects clear of the rotating agitator blades during operation.
- Emergency Stop: Familiarize yourself with how to quickly shut off the air supply in an emergency.

4. Setup and Installation
4.1 Unpacking
- Carefully remove all components from the packaging.
- Inspect all parts for any signs of shipping damage. If damage is found, do not proceed with assembly and contact your supplier immediately.
- Verify that all listed components are present.
4.2 Assembly
- Attach the agitator arm with the stainless steel blades to the motor shaft. Ensure it is securely fastened.
- Secure the clamp mechanism to the motor assembly.
4.3 Mounting the Mixer
- Select a suitable mixing tank or barrel (up to 50 gallons / 200 liters capacity).
- Position the mixer over the tank. Use the adjustable clamp to securely attach the mixer to the rim of the tank. Tighten the clamp firmly to prevent movement during operation.
- Ensure the agitator blades are submerged in the liquid to be mixed, but maintain sufficient clearance from the bottom and sides of the tank to prevent damage and allow for proper circulation.
4.4 Air Supply Connection
- Connect a clean, dry, and regulated air supply line to the air inlet port on the mixer.
- The recommended air pressure is 6-9mpa (approximately 87-130 psi).
- It is highly recommended to use an air filter, regulator, and lubricator (FRL unit) in your air line to ensure the air is clean, at the correct pressure, and lubricated, which will prolong the life of the pneumatic motor.
- Ensure all air connections are tight to prevent leaks.
5. Operating Instructions
5.1 Before Operation
- Verify that the mixer is securely mounted to the tank.
- Confirm that the air supply is connected and regulated to the correct pressure.
- Ensure the agitator blades are free to rotate and are properly submerged in the material.
5.2 Starting and Speed Adjustment
- Slowly open the regulating switch located near the air inlet to start the pneumatic motor.
- Adjust the regulating switch to control the mixing speed. Turn clockwise to increase speed and counter-clockwise to decrease speed. The mixer supports a speed range of 0-1440 revolutions per minute (r/min).
- Begin mixing at a lower speed and gradually increase as needed, observing the material's consistency and avoiding splashing.
5.3 Mixing Process
- Allow the mixer to operate for the required duration until the desired homogeneity or consistency of the material is achieved.
- Monitor the mixing process to ensure efficient operation and adjust speed if necessary.
5.4 Stopping the Mixer
- Slowly close the regulating switch completely to stop the motor.
- Once the blades have stopped rotating, disconnect the air supply from the mixer.

6. Maintenance
Regular maintenance ensures the longevity and optimal performance of your pneumatic mixer.
6.1 Cleaning
- After each use, especially when changing materials, thoroughly clean the agitator arm and blades. This prevents material buildup and cross-contamination.
- Use appropriate cleaning agents for the materials mixed. Disconnect the air supply before cleaning.
6.2 Lubrication
- The pneumatic motor requires regular lubrication. If using an FRL unit, ensure the lubricator is filled with appropriate pneumatic tool oil.
- If not using an FRL unit, apply a few drops of pneumatic tool oil directly into the air inlet before and after each use.
6.3 Air Supply Quality
- Ensure your air compressor provides clean, dry air. Moisture and contaminants can damage the pneumatic motor.
- Regularly drain condensation from your air compressor tank.
6.4 Inspection
- Periodically inspect the agitator blades, shaft, clamp, and air connections for signs of wear, damage, or leaks.
- Replace any worn or damaged parts immediately to prevent further issues and ensure safe operation.
6.5 Storage
- When not in use, store the mixer in a clean, dry environment, protected from dust and extreme temperatures.
7. Troubleshooting
Refer to the table below for common issues and their potential solutions.
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Mixer not starting | No air supply, low air pressure, regulating switch closed, motor blockage. | Check air compressor, ensure air line is connected, open regulating switch, inspect motor for obstructions. |
| Low power or speed | Insufficient air pressure, lack of lubrication, air leaks, motor wear. | Increase air pressure, lubricate motor, check for and seal air leaks, consider motor service if wear is suspected. |
| Excessive vibration | Mixer not securely clamped, bent agitator arm or damaged blades, improper liquid level. | Tighten clamp, inspect and replace damaged components, adjust liquid level to ensure blades are fully submerged and balanced. |
| Air leaks | Loose connections, damaged hoses or seals. | Tighten all air line connections, inspect hoses and seals for damage and replace if necessary. |
